Which statement regarding sinusoidal functions, sine, and cosine is accurate?

A) cos is an even function, cos(-x) = -cos(x)
B) sin is an odd function, sin(-x) = -sin(x)
C) the sin function can be reflected over the x-axis or y-axis without alteration
D) the cosine function can be reflected over the x-axis without alteration

Final answer:

The accurate statement is that sin is an odd function, sin(-x) = -sin(x).

Step-by-step explanation:

Answer: Option B) sin is an odd function, sin(-x) = -sin(x)

To determine if this statement is accurate, we need to understand the properties of sine and cosine functions. The sine function is an odd function, which means that sin(-x) = -sin(x).
